Victor



noun
1.
(the winner in a battle or contest) អ្នកឈ្នះ, អ្នកបរាជ័យ
2.
(បច្ចេកទេស) អ្នកឈ្នះ
ENGLISH MEANING
noun
1.
The winner in a contest; one who gets the better of another in any struggle; esp., one who defeats an enemy in battle; a vanquisher; a conqueror; -- often followed by art, rarely by of.
1.
A destroyer
2.
Victorious